Victorian Mauchline Ball String Wool Holder GLASGOW

This is a large Victorian, Scottish Mauchline Ware string or wool holder, in the Transfer Ware finish showing 2 images of Glasgow, & dating to around 1880.

The holder is made of copal varnished sycamore, & is in the form of a globe or ball standing on three small legs.

The interior of the box is unvarnished

The two halves of the box fit together in the centre by means of a 'push fit', with the top half having a protruding lip & a turned hole on the top. The spool of string or wool would be placed in the box, with the end of the string being fed through the hole, thus keeping the spool of string tidy & tangle free.

The handle of the box is a short length of cord which has been threaded through two small holes either side of the main 'string' hole, & knotted to the inside.

There are two transfer printed scenes on either side of the box entitled 'GEORGE SQUARE, GLASGOW', and 'TRONGATE, GLASGOW'.

Condition is Fine, with no damage at all. The box has it's original legs, which is unusual as these are quite thin & fragile and prone to breaking off.

The box stands approx 4 1/4" in height, & 4" in diameter (11 cm x 10.3 cm).
